2,5-Dichloro-3-methylthiophene

Description:
2,5-Dichloro-3-methylthiophene is a heterocyclic organic compound characterized by a five-membered aromatic ring containing sulfur, specifically a thiophene structure. The presence of two chlorine atoms at the 2 and 5 positions and a methylthio group at the 3 position contributes to its unique chemical properties. This compound is typically a colorless to pale yellow liquid with a distinctive odor. It is soluble in organic solvents but has limited solubility in water due to its hydrophobic nature. The chlorinated and methylthio substituents enhance its reactivity, making it useful in various chemical syntheses and applications, including agrochemicals and pharmaceuticals. Formula:C5H4Cl2S
InChI:InChI=1/C5H4Cl2S/c1-3-2-4(6)8-5(3)7/h2H,1H3
SMILES:Cc1cc(Cl)sc1Cl
Synonyms:
  • 2,5-Dichlor-3-methylthiophen
  • Thiophene, 2,5-dichloro-3-methyl-
  • 2,5-Dichloro-3-methylthiophene
